Ernest Blanc-Garin
Ernest Blanc-Garin, also known as Ernest-Stanislas Blanc-Garin, was a French painter born on 8 October 1843 in Givet, France. He studied at the Académie Royale des Beaux-Arts in Brussels and later ran a workshop in Brussels, where he taught many students. He died in Brussels in 1916 at the age of 72 or 73.
